    Problem solving 27 use and care manual problem: may be caused by: what to do: washing copper with sterling silver yellow film on sterling silver results when you wash copper utensils in same load. Silver polish will usually remove this type of stain. Yellow or brown marks (cont.) tea or coffee (tann...
